Cortado Brings Enterprise Mobility to a New Level, Focusing on Impressive Productivity Gains

The new Cortado Corporate Server 7.2 improves mobile teamwork and collaboration with native iOS printing, enhanced file sharing and intelligent file storage for teams

(BERLIN/DENVER, June 11, 2014) Cortado releases a new version of its enterprise mobility solution Cortado Corporate Server. The Windows-based software is securely installed on premise in the corporate network. The clear focus of version 7.2 is on the user, their experience, vastly improved collaboration and productivity. To achieve this, proven features like file sharing and mobile printing have been significantly enhanced and new features introduced like Smart Filing, which ensures intelligent file storage for teams.

The new version 7.2 of Cortado Corporate Server firmly places the focus on flawless, user-oriented productivity and mobile collaboration features.

Among the highlights are full iOS printing support, for example using Microsoft’s new Office for iPad suite that now also supports AirPrint. Even for those apps that don’t support native iOS printing, users can still print with the Open In feature. Thanks to Cortado Corporate Server’s Active Directory integration, iPad or iPhone users have exactly the same list of printers available, which they have on their desktop.

Patent-pending Smart Filing technology enables intelligent filing in order to avoid version conflicts, multiple copies of files and saving to incorrect locations. Instead, files are automatically saved right back to the corporate network, in the right place, without any version conflicts and without any danger of loss of older versions.

To simplify file sharing as much as possible among teams with both internal and external employees and to also ensure the highest levels of security, Cortado Corporate Server offers Smart Sharing, which offers situation-based file sharing. If users address a recipient outside the company, a copy of the file is automatically created in the cloud. The corporate network with the original file remains inaccessible, and secure, from the outside.

A further important factor for teamwork: Microsoft SharePoint can now be fully integrated as a network drive, allowing users to access it just like any other file system. This significantly simplifies teamwork among employees using different mobile platforms.

For IT departments, Cortado Corporate Server 7.2 also includes a range of further improvements. For example, the Fast Enrollment feature allows mobile devices to be fully integrated into the corporate IT environment by simply scanning a QR code. Knowledge of the user’s personal password is not even necessary to configure all certificates, the mobile device management (MDM) profile and the Cortado Client on the mobile device.
